The cheapest way to get from Hamburg Airport (HAM) to Aachen is to drive which costs €65 - €100 and takes 4h 18m.
The fastest way to get from Hamburg Airport (HAM) to Aachen is to fly and train which takes 3h 24m and costs €110 - €380.
No, there is no direct bus from Hamburg Airport (HAM) to Aachen. However, there are services departing from Hamburg Airport and arriving at Aachen - 58, Peterstraße via Hannover Hbf and Südviertel, Essen.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 5m.
No, there is no direct train from Hamburg Airport (HAM) to Aachen. However, there are services departing from Hamburg Airport and arriving at Aachen West via Hamburg Hbf and Duesseldorf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 7m.
The distance between Hamburg Airport (HAM) and Aachen is 437 km. The road distance is 476.5 km.
